检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
具体的步骤(包括实名认证)可以看先前一篇文章《华为云CodeCheck代码检查插件(CloudIDE版本)使用指南》中的第1和第2小节。
代码检查(CodeCheck)是面向软件开发者提供代码质量管理云服务,可在线进行多种语言的代码静态检查、代码安全检查、质量评分、代码缺陷改进趋势分析,辅助您管控代码质量。
本帖最后由 DevCloud 于 2017-9-22 16:12 编辑 <br />
1、新建代码仓2、点击开始代码检查,大概1分钟完成检查3、查看检查问题项4、更新检查任务的规则集5、设置检查任务的执行计划,完成以下步骤设置,代码每次体检后系统自动执行代码检查6、创建问题缺陷单7、使用代码健康度徽标8、执行分支检查9、查看服务规则能力分布
代码检查(CodeCheck)是基于云端实现代码质量管理的服务,软件开发者可在编码完成后执行多语言的代码静态检查和安全检查,获取全面的质量报告,并提供缺陷的改进建议和趋势分析,有效管控代码质量,降低成本。
针对本节的问题,是否应该让门禁级和IDE级检查的范围保持一致,就不是简单的YES OR NO了,需要考虑本项目代码检查的侧重点和代码检查工具使用流程的差异,明白安全左移里的左移也并非是无限制、无条件的。
IDEA本地版本)使用指南: https://bbs.huaweicloud.com/blogs/390135 华为云CodeCheck代码检查插件(CloudIDE版本)使用指南:https://bbs.huaweicloud.com/blogs/320842 华为云CodeCheck
更新日志代码检查支持PHP语言代码检查上线76条C/C++规则屏蔽问题历史操作记录修改为时间轴样式规则集过滤器中自定义规则集拆分为我的自定义规则集、他人自定义规则集CloudIDEPortal启动画面提示用户是否正在升级用户从代码仓库进入CloudIDE可以选择技术栈Java、Javascript
每次合并代码后进行代码检查,是增量检查还是全量检查?
https://github.com/ChenTF/iOS-sonarShell.git SonarQube Plugin for Objective C This repository
1592875958354090484.png
误报是指代码检查服务错误地报告了一个不存在的问题或一个错误的问题类型的状况。误报一般是由于代码检查规则的设计缺陷、实现错误、使用场景不匹配或配置不当等原因造成的,会导致开发人员和测试人员对代码检查服务的信任度降低。
2.1 自定义规则集在访问CodeCheckBenchmark项目,并进入“代码”-“代码检查”后,在“规则集”页面“新增规则集”,输入规则集名称rs-npe-java、检查语言等,如图2所示。
https://mp.weixin.qq.com/s?__biz=MzA5MjM5OTYzNA==&mid=2247486915&idx=1&sn=060e93d6e40f99b2fd9a22e54799bac2&chksm=906cfcbea71b75a809e5a05e7f87919cf90373aa66470879f397d7804e5462c9df028a9ed9d2&
发文的版块名:热门技术领域 DevCloud发文的标题名:【基于华为云DevCloud代码检查服务的DevSecOps应用体验分享】帖子内容链接:https://bbs.huaweicloud.com/forum/thread-47628-1-1.html是codelabs的体验操作记录
通过CodeArts代码检查为Gitlab设置合并检查门禁
发文的版块名:热门技术领域 DevCloud发文的标题名:【基于华为云DevCloud代码检查服务的DevSecOps应用体验分享】帖子内容链接:https://bbs.huaweicloud.com/forum/thread-48242-1-1.html是codelabs的体验操作记录
如题,因为代码检查非常重要,我们希望知道代码检查工具的后端引擎是啥,谢谢。
如下图所示:Select-Statement can be transformed. 1.6% of fields used. “Select-Statement can be transformed 1.6% of fields used” 这个报警提示的含义是,你在编写 ABAP